California Products Company has the following data as part of its budget for the 2nd quarter:
 Apr  May  Jun  Cash collections $30,000$32,000$36,000 Cash payments:  Purdhess af inventory 4,5004,6003,800 Operating Expenses 7,2007,6008,000 Capital expenditures 024,5005,200\begin{array} { | l | r | r | r | } \hline & { \text { Apr } } & { \text { May } } &{ \text { Jun } } \\\hline \text { Cash collections } & \$ 30,000 & \$ 32,000 & \$ 36,000 \\\hline \text { Cash payments: } & & & \\\hline \text { Purdhess af inventory } & 4,500 & 4,600 & 3,800 \\\hline \text { Operating Expenses } & 7,200 & 7,600 & 8,000 \\\hline \text { Capital expenditures } & 0 & 24,500 & 5,200 \\\hline\end{array}
The cash balance at April 1 is forecast to be $8,200. Please prepare a cash budget using the following format:
 Cash Budget  Apr  May  Jun  Beginning cash balance  Cash collections  Cash available  Cash payments:  Purchases of inventory  Operating expenses  Capital expenditures  Total cash payments  Finding casin balance \begin{array}{|l|l|l|l|}\hline \text { Cash Budget } & \text { Apr } & \text { May } & \text { Jun } \\\hline \text { Beginning cash balance } & & & \\\text { Cash collections } & & & \\\hline \text { Cash available } & & & \\\hline \text { Cash payments: } & & & \\\hline \text { Purchases of inventory } & & & \\\hline \text { Operating expenses } & & & \\\hline \text { Capital expenditures } & & & \\\hline \text { Total cash payments } & & & \\\hline \text { Finding casin balance } & & & \\\hline \end{array}

Narcolepsy

Narcolepsy is a chronic sleep disorder characterized by overwhelming daytime drowsiness and sudden attacks of sleep, often leading to significant disruptions in daily life.

Hallucinates

The experience of sensing things that are not present in the external environment as if they are real, often a symptom in psychological disorders.

Sleep Attacks

Sudden and irresistible episodes of sleep occurring in disorders such as narcolepsy, characterized by excessive daytime sleepiness.

Animal Magnetism

A historical term referring to a supposed invisible natural force possessed by all living things, including humans, thought to affect health and disease.
